Overview

1N4728A-T from Diodes Incorporated is a 1.0 W, 3.3 V ±5% Zener diode in DO-41 glass package, with 76 mA test current, 10 Ω maximum Zener impedance at IZT, and -0.08 to -0.05 %/°C temperature coefficient. It provides precision voltage regulation in low-power analog reference and overvoltage protection circuits.

For engineers reviewing the 1N4728A-T datasheet, 1N4728A-T pinout, 1N4728A-T application, or 1N4728A-T equivalent, key selection criteria include nominal Zener voltage tolerance, thermal resistance (175 °C/W), surge current rating (1380 mA for 8.3 ms), and DO-41 mechanical compatibility with through-hole PCB layouts.

Technical Context

This Zener diode operates in reverse breakdown mode to maintain stable 3.3 V across its terminals under controlled current conditions. Its sharp knee characteristic is verified by dual-point Zener impedance measurement (at IZT and IZK) per JEDEC standards.

Designed for DC voltage reference and clamping, it exhibits a negative temperature coefficient (-0.08 to -0.05 %/°C), requiring thermal derating above 50°C (6.67 mW/°C) and strict lead length control (9.5 mm) to sustain full 1.0 W power dissipation.

Key Specifications

ParameterValue and Actual Design Meaning
Zener Voltage3.3 V ±5% - defines regulated output voltage under 76 mA test current
Power Dissipation1.0 W - maximum continuous DC power at 25°C ambient, derates linearly above 50°C
Zener Impedance10 Ω max @ IZT - ensures minimal voltage variation under dynamic load changes
Reverse Leakage100 µA max @ 1.0 V - guarantees low standby current in high-impedance bias networks
Surge Current1380 mA @ 8.3 ms - supports transient overvoltage suppression without failure
Temp Coefficient-0.08 to -0.05 %/°C - quantifies voltage drift with temperature for stability-critical references

FAQ

What is the maximum allowable junction temperature for 1N4728A-T?

The 1N4728A-T has an operating junction temperature range of -65°C to +175°C. At 25°C ambient, full 1.0 W power dissipation is permitted; above 50°C ambient, power must be linearly derated at 6.67 mW/°C to prevent exceeding the 175°C maximum junction temperature.

How does the -0.08 to -0.05 %/°C temperature coefficient affect circuit performance?

This negative temperature coefficient means the Zener voltage decreases by 0.05–0.08% per °C rise. Over a 100°C range (e.g., -25°C to +75°C), the 3.3 V nominal voltage shifts by approximately -16.5 to -26.4 mV, which must be accounted for in precision reference designs.

Is 1N4728A-T compatible with lead-free reflow soldering processes?

No - the 1N4728A-T uses Sn96.5Ag3.5 finish and is rated for wave and hand soldering per MIL-STD-202 Method 208. Its glass DO-41 package is not rated for peak reflow temperatures (>260°C); use only traditional through-hole soldering methods.

Why is the 8.3 ms surge current rating specified, and what does 1380 mA represent?

The 8.3 ms duration corresponds to one half-cycle of 60 Hz AC line frequency. The 1380 mA rating indicates the peak non-repetitive current the device can safely absorb during such transients without parametric shift or catastrophic failure, validated per industry surge testing standards.
